Air France commercial partnership with Flybe: 45 new routes
Starting this autumn, Air France customers will have access to 45 new routes between France and the UK and 17 routes on Flybe's domestic network, via Birmingham, Manchester and Southampton, thanks to a new commercial pertnership announced today by both airlines.

BAA: Significant progress in subordinated debt refinancing
British Airport Authority (BAA) has completed a £625 million, four-year 'Class B' bank junior debt facility, marking significant progress towards a refinancing of the group's subordinated debt of £1.57 billion.

Air France Foundation currently supports more than 90 projects around the world
The Air France Foundation currently supports more than 90 projects including 30 in Africa, 17 in Asia, 9 in Latin America, 8 in the Caribbean and Indian Ocean, 3 in Eastern Europe and a unilateral-scale project covering several countries. In France, 24 projects are also funded, notably in Toulouse which has been elected priority city in 2010.
